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Damage: The severity of the foundation damage will directly impact the cost of repairs.
- Foundation Type: Different foundation types (slab, crawl space, basement) require different repair techniques and costs.
- Soil Conditions: The type of soil and its stability can influence the complexity and cost of the repair.
- Accessibility: The ease of access to the foundation can affect labor costs.
- Repair Method: Various methods (piering, slabjacking) have different costs associated with them.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
- Contractor Rates: Rates can vary depending on the contractor's experience and demand in Sioux City, IA.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Sioux City, IA) |
---|---|
Foundation Inspection | $300 - $600 |
Soil Stabilization | $2,000 - $6,500 |
Piering (per pier) |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Slabjacking (per section) | $500 - $1,300 |
Crack Repair (per crack) | $300 - $800 |
Waterproofing | $2,000 - $7,000 |
Full Foundation Replacement | $20,000 - $100,000 |
